Tata Motors has introduced the Altroz iCNG hatchback in India, priced at Rs 7.55 lakh (ex-showroom). This model stands out as the first CNG-powered hatchback to feature a sunroof, showcasing Tata’s new dual-cylinder setup for CNG tanks.

Visually, the Altroz iCNG bears a striking resemblance to its petrol-powered counterpart, with the only noticeable distinction being the addition of the ‘iCNG’ badge on the tailgate. To maximize boot space, Tata has positioned the two 30-litre CNG tanks beneath the boot floor. This design change allows for a 210-litre boot capacity, which is 135 litres less than the standard Altroz’s 345-litre boot.

Inside the cabin, minimal alterations have been made in comparison to the petrol Altroz. It retains the 7.0-inch touchscreen with Android Auto and Apple CarPlay connectivity, along with features like an air purifier, wireless charger, and automatic headlamps. The notable addition is the inclusion of a voice-activated, single-pane sunroof on select trims, namely the XM+ (S), XZ+ (S), and XZ+ O (S).

Under the hood, the Altroz iCNG is powered by a 1.2-litre petrol engine paired with a 5-speed manual gearbox. In petrol mode, it generates 88hp and 115Nm of torque, while in CNG mode, the output decreases to 77hp and 103Nm of torque. Notably, the Altroz can start directly in CNG mode, distinguishing it from its rivals, the Maruti Suzuki Baleno CNG and Toyota Glanza CNG, which produce similar power but lower torque in their CNG modes.

Here’s the complete price list of Altroz CNG (all prices are ex-showroom & introductory)

VariantPrice
Tata Altroz iCNG XERs. 7,55,400/-
Tata Altroz iCNG XM+Rs. 8,40,400/-
Tata Altroz iCNG XM+ (S)Rs. 8,84,900/-
Tata Altroz iCNG XZRs. 9,52,900/-
Tata Altroz iCNG XZ+ (S)Rs. 10,02,990/-
Tata Altroz iCNG XZ+O (S)Rs. 10,54,990/-

Competing against the Maruti Suzuki Baleno CNG (priced between Rs 8.35 lakh and Rs 9.28 lakh) and Toyota Glanza CNG (priced between Rs 8.50 lakh and Rs 9.53 lakh), the Altroz iCNG comes with a starting price that is Rs 80,000 lower than the Baleno CNG and Rs 95,000 lower than the Glanza CNG. However, as the Altroz iCNG is available in more trims, the top-spec Altroz CNG XZ+ O (S) is priced Rs 1.27 lakh higher than the Baleno CNG and Rs 1.2 lakh higher than the Glanza CNG.
